WebOligarchy breeds political dynasties Philippine Star columnist Carmen N Pedrosa believes that oligarchy has become a culture in the Philippines . 'Our culture is so deeply imbibed with the ambition for wealth and power,' she said in her column 'From a Distance' published by the Philippine Star on 10 July 2010. Web12 jun. 2024 · Oligarchy An oligarchy is a society that places power in the hands of a few. As with any system that distributes power extremely unevenly, this tends to be unpopular such that it would tend to face resistance. As such, an oligarchy may turn to authoritarian methods in an attempt to hold on to power.
